The 1.1 Signature monaural line-level preamp is a direct replacement for the L1 Signature, which since its introduction in 2010 has become the absolute benchmark of excellence among LAMM line-level preamps. The signature L L 1.1 proudly continues this tradition.
The L2.1 Reference is based on a Class A circuit from input to output without general negative feedback. All cascades, including the high—voltage output, are single-cycle. Selected high-voltage transistors (MOSFETs) are used in the signal path, and the volume control is implemented on a high-quality TKD step potentiometer (Tokyo Ko-on Denpa).
